Frequently asked questions
What is 21 Garden Street's energy grade?
21 Garden Street scores 56 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band C (Below median (55–69)) — in its 2024 New York City dis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.
How much energy does 21 Garden Street use?
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 87.1 kBtu/ft² (112.3 kBtu/ft² source) across 50,936 sq ft, including 178,500 kWh of electricity and 38,250 therms of natural gas.
What are 21 Garden Street's carbon emissions?
21 Garden Street reported 273 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(5.4 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. Under Local Law 97, buildings over 25,000 sq ft face carbon caps with fines of $268 per metric ton of CO₂e over the limit, phasing in from 2024.
